The distance from Glentanner Airport (GTN) to John F Kennedy International Airport (JFK) is 9245 miles or 14877 kilometers or 8028 nautical miles.

Why should you arrive 3 hours before international flight?
Flyers who are traveling to an international destination should arrive at the airport earlier than domestic flyers. This is because international flights can have additional check-in requirements, like passport verification, that need to be completed before you receive your boarding pass.
